苹果分析师指美5G部署延後将碍5G版iPhone销售
着名苹果分析师,Loup Ventures联合创办人Gene Munster接受《CNBC》访问时表示,苹果投资者须下调对明年5G版iPhone的预期,销售表现将令市场失望。他指美国电讯商延後部署5G设备为主因,5G覆盖网络需要时间。
Munster对美国电讯商声称明年底5G覆盖率达75%的说法,认为这是最乐观情况下的假设,又指覆盖问题将对5G版iPhone销售构成压力。但他相信苹果股价明年仍会上升,股价可达350至400美元。苹果上周收市报275.15美元。
